Changelog v0.1.8 (source)

- Annunciator clarity/resolution improved

- Minor exterior texture improvements

- Performance (FPS) improvements  

  • EFB upgrades:
  • Doubled screen resolution
  • Interactive checklists, in addition to the existing MSFS checklist support
  • A top-of-descent calculator with the option to manually input altitudes, speeds and descent requirements or to have those sync'd from the sim
  • An on-screen/virtual keyboard, especially useful for VR users
  • An improved Navigraph charts screen with automatic selection of departure and arrival airports based on your SimBrief OFP, and ability to favourite charts for quick reference
  • METARs for your SimBrief OFP departure, arrival and alternate airports

- FDE tweaks (including improvements to the CG)

- Autopilot Go-Around (GA) mode fixes

- Airbrakes now extend further when hydraulic pressure is depleted

- Roll spoiler deployment range more closely matches the real aircraft

- ADF frequency now increments in 0.5 rather than 0.1 kHz steps

- ALT ARM no longer disengages when the selected altitude is changed

- Engine fan blade animations fixed on the -200QT and -300 variants

- Take-off callout logic tweaked to reduce delays between V1, VR, V2 and gear up calls

- Storm panel lighting added

- IOAT and auxiliary pitot probes added to exterior

- Water servicing door added to exterior

- Use of anti-icing (engine/airframe) now affects engine performance, reducing N1 by approx. 1% and increasing fuel flow by approx. 9% 

- VHF NAV 1 display tweaked to more closely match the real unit

- GPU beacon light effect added

- EFB config menu option added for disabling visible QC/QT cargo containers (for GSX users)

- Ice detection warning logic changes

- INCREASE/DECREASE AP PITCH HOLD REFERENCE ASSIGNMENT logic fixed, allowing for control over autopilot pitch or vertical speed

- SU10 compatibility changes

- Manual updated to reflect software changes, control assignments section added
